Subject: Q3 Inventory Write-Down — briefing for sales leads

Team,

Following the stocktake at the Ferndale depot, we will record a write-down of roughly 6% of finished goods, mainly the discontinued Solvane 200 line. Valuation was reviewed twice and signed off by audit. Please avoid quoting legacy stock in open proposals until revised price lists arrive next week. The rationale ties into plans we are keeping close, summarised confidentially below.

confidential, yahip-hagug: Gorixax Logistics plans to lower the Ulaael list price by 26.6 percent in October. The pricing group signed off on a budget of $199.9 million for Project Holix. The renewal with Kasdorox Systems closes at $137.5 million a year, 8.2 percent above the last contract. Project Lamion slips by a full year because of the audit delay.

Runbook: cron drift on Tollbar scheduler. Symptom: nightly jobs start 3–9 minutes late. First check NTP sync on the worker pool, then compare scheduler tick logs against wall clock. Known cause: overloaded leader node re-electing mid-tick. Escalate to the Platform rotation if drift exceeds ten minutes. Before debugging, confirm the node is running with the expected settings listed here.

deployment values, yadug-bawif:
[framir]
team = pelox
access_code = ac_a38ab2
owner = tamion.julael
host = framir.tolvaqlabs.test
port = 11211
peer = tammir.zemvargrid.local
salt = 2215ef03
pin = 1541

The renewal of our three-year agreement with Torvane Materials has been assessed in detail. Proposed terms include a 4.2% unit-price increase, partially offset by improved volume rebates and extended payment terms of sixty days. Sensitivity analysis indicates a net annual cost impact of under 1% on the Meridia product line, assuming stable demand. Legal has flagged no material changes to liability clauses. We recommend approval, subject to the conditions outlined in the confidential note below.

confidential, yawip-bahif: Zorokox Partners plans to lower the Casax list price by 28.0 percent in April. The board signed off on a budget of $271.0 million for Project Juldor. The renewal with Pelokox Partners closes at $410.1 million a year, 3.4 percent below the last contract. Project Pelok slips by a full year because of the audit delay.